Hardwood Floor Installation Pricing in Washington
In Washington, the average cost for hardwood floor installation is $12 per sq ft (installed), which is 15% higher than the national average of $10. Most Washington residents pay between $7 and $21.
Washington has a higher cost of living than most states, which translates to higher labor rates and material costs. Urban areas within Washington may be even higher.
Hardwood flooring installation includes the wood planks, underlayment, installation labor, and finishing. Prices shown are per square foot including materials and labor.

What Affects Hardwood Floor Installation Cost in Washington?
Wood Type
Oak: $6-$12/sq ft. Maple: $7-$13/sq ft. Walnut: $10-$18/sq ft. Brazilian cherry: $12-$22/sq ft
Solid vs Engineered
Solid: $8-$18/sq ft. Engineered: $6-$14/sq ft
💡 Tips to Save on Hardwood Floor Installation in Washington
- 1.Engineered hardwood costs less and works in more situations than solid
- 2.Choose domestic species (oak, maple) over exotic for significant savings
- 3.Buy material during holiday sales
- 4.Have all rooms done at once for volume discounts

How long does hardwood flooring last?
Solid hardwood can last 75-100 years with refinishing every 7-10 years. Engineered lasts 20-50 years.
